First Shift (United States of America)UofL Health is seeking a dynamic Registered Dietitian to provide exceptional patient care in the inpatient setting. The Nutrition Therapy team of dietitians provides services in the acute inpatient, outpatient, rehabilitation, behavioral health, and oncology arenas. The successful candidate will have:

• Excellent communication and customer service skills to serve as a nutrition resource for patients, staff, and community
• Excellent time management skills and ability to self-motivate, necessary in this high paced environment
• Commitment to professionalism, integrity, nutrition as a healing therapy, and ethical practice

Responsible for providing direct comprehensive nutrition services using evidence-based clinical standards of care to assess complex patient nutritional needs.
Identifies patients at risk, and provides treatment and therapy by coordinating medical nutrition support and directing nutrition care.
Assists with developing operating standards as needed and tools for promotion of optimum nutrition intake to increase treatment tolerance and quality of life.
Integrates patient nutrition support and management goals by collaborating with the medical and interdisciplinary healthcare team.
Utilizes information systems to successfully coordinate patient care.
Teaches and counsels patients, families, and care givers as an element of the inclusive care and treatment provided.
Keeps abreast of the most recent nutrition-related research, policy, certifications, and standards of practice.
Involved with the evaluation, assessment, and education of transplant patients at select facilities.
Trained to become competent at enteral tube placement and nasal bridling at select facilities.

About UofL Health

UofL Health is a not-for-profit 501(c)(3) fully integrated regional academic health system with nine hospitals, four medical centers, Brown Cancer Center, Eye Institute, more than 250 physician practice locations, and more than 1,200 providers in Louisville and the surrounding counties, including southern Indiana. Additional access to UofL Health is provided through a partnership with Carroll County Memorial Hospital.

Affiliated with the University of Louisville School of Medicine, UofL Health is committed to providing patients with access to the most advanced care available. This includes clinical trials, collaboration on research and the development of new technologies to both save and improve lives. With more than 14,000 team members – physicians, surgeons, nurses, pharmacists and other highly-skilled health care professionals, UofL Health is focused on one mission: to transform the health of communities we serve through compassionate, innovative, patient-centered care.
